"Velvet-covered slim-line hangers are one of my favorite closet upgrades. They take up less space than traditional plastic or wooden hangers, allowing you to fit more clothing while maintaining a uniform, streamlined look. Plus, the velvet texture prevents garments from slipping off, so your closet stays tidy. You'll also immediately notice a difference when you use just one color of hangers in your closet, as using just one color reduces the visual clutter."

—Lauren Saltman, professional organizer and owner at Living. Simplified.
